Borealis BorSafe™ ME3440 Black Medium Density Polyethylene for Pressure Pipes
Categories: Polymer; Thermoplastic; Polyethylene (PE); Medium Density (MDPE); Medium Density Polyethylene (MDPE), Extruded

Material Notes: ME3440 is a black, bimodal medium density polyethylene compound classified as a MRS 8.0 material (PE80), with optimum balance between flexibility and strength, produced with the advanced Borstar technology. Well dispersed carbon black gives outstanding UV resistance. Long-term stability is ensured by an optimized stabilization system.

ME3440 is recommended for pressure pipe systems in the application fields of drinking water, natural gas, pressure sewerage, relining, sea outfall and industrial, particularly where flexibility and coilability is of importance. It also shows excellent resistance to rapid crack propagation and slow crack growth. Thanks to the structure, it gives outstanding extrudability, compared to conventional PE80 products.

Former trade name for this product was Borstar®.

Physical PropertiesOriginal ValueComments
Density 0.940 g/ccBase Resin; ISO 1183
 0.951 g/ccCompound; ISO 1183
ESCR 10% Igepal® >= 5000 hourASTM D1693-A
Carbon Black Loading >= 2.0 %ASTM D1603
Melt Flow 0.20 g/10 min
@Load 2.16 kg,
Temperature 190 °C
ISO 1133
 0.85 g/10 min
@Load 5.00 kg,
Temperature 190 °C
ISO 1133
 
Mechanical PropertiesOriginal ValueComments
Tensile Strength, Yield 2755 psiAt 50 mm/min; ISO 527-2
Elongation at Break 600 %ISO 527-2
Elongation at Yield 10 %ISO 527-2
Tensile Modulus 0.800 GPaAt 1 mm/min; ISO 527-2
Charpy Impact, Notched 0.200 J/cm²ISO 179/1eA
 
Thermal PropertiesOriginal ValueComments
Brittleness Temperature <= -70.0 °CASTM D746
 
Processing PropertiesOriginal ValueComments
Front Barrel Temperature 180 - 210 °C
Die Temperature 392 - 410 °F
Melt Temperature 200 - 220 °C
Head Temperature 200 - 210 °C
 
Descriptive Properties
Resistance to Rapid Crack Propagation, BAR7ISO 13477, Pc at 0°C, S4 / pipe size 250 mm SDR 11
